Joseph's life is a testament to the intricate and often unpredictable path that God lays out for us. His journey from being sold into slavery by his brothers to becoming the second most powerful man in Egypt is filled with lessons of faith, patience, and resilience. Joseph's story teaches us that God's plans are not always straightforward, but they are always purposeful. The detours and delays we experience are not signs of God's absence but are part of His divine strategy to prepare us for the destiny He has in store.
In our own lives, we may face moments of uncertainty and fear, much like Joseph did. However, these moments are opportunities for growth and transformation. They are the crucibles in which our character is refined and our faith is strengthened. As we navigate the twists and turns of our journey, we must trust in God's timing and His plan, knowing that He is with us every step of the way.
